What is a PCB?

A PCB (Printed Circuit Board) is also known as a circuit board and is primarily used for electronic components as their carrier. The PCB is an essential electronic component that serves as the support structure and electrical connection platform for electronic components. Since it is manufactured using electronic printing techniques, it is referred to as a "printed" circuit board.

How is RoHS Testing Conducted for PCB Boards?

A PCB consists mainly of three materials: pads, substrate, and paint. Each material can be tested separately. For instance, if only the pad material needs testing, the pad from the PCB board is taken for RoHS testing. Alternatively, the entire PCB board can be tested as a mixed sample without separating materials.
